There is one rec league that I worked for a couple years, in which there were a lot of jerks -- parents, coaches, players. It was good for me to work it for a while but when my time got full of other games, I didn't feel bad about dropping it. But I learned a lot, and it was valuable experience. I suggest you get one of those more experienced refs that can handle this stuff, I think you said there were a couple, and work only with them. Tell them you want suggestions of how you could be more like them. Absorb. It'll pay huge dividends in the long run, I think.
